Transaction 153a6cc56a51449ead2f3f52754f0f5ffaceb72da99a0133fd65eff7d1485fb0
1 Input
1 Outputs
- 153a6cc56a51449ead2f3f52754f0f5ffaceb72da99a0133fd65eff7d1485fb0:0
value 683227
address 1PRQDo1kw4MQiodK6huPc2cr4Gu1XCCiTP